Abstract
We evaluate the 4-point function of the auxiliary field in the critical O(N) sigma model at O(1/N) and show that it describes the exchange of tensor currents of arbitrary even rank l>0. These are dual to tensor gauge fields of the same rank in the AdS theory, which supports the recent hypothesis of Klebanov and Polyakov. Their couplings to two auxiliary fields are also derived.
